软件推荐 › Open WebUI

Open WebUI

LLM网页客户端

适用系统:WEB

软件介绍

Open WebUI 是一款功能丰富、用户友好的自托管 Web 用户界面,旨在与大型语言模型(LLM)进行交互,特别是支持 Ollama 和与 OpenAI 兼容的 API。

主要功能:

  • 多模型支持:允许同时与多个模型对话,方便比较不同模型的输出结果。
  • 图文对话:支持图文对话功能(需模型支持多模态),增强交互体验。
  • 文档 RAG:内置文档检索增强生成(RAG)功能,提升对话的上下文理解能力。
  • 语音输入和输出:支持语音输入和输出,提供更自然的交互方式。
  • 网页链接对话:支持通过网页链接进行对话,自动下载页面进行 RAG 检索。
  • 端侧运行 Python:利用 WebAssembly 技术,在用户侧运行 Python 代码,降低使用门槛。

安装方法:

推荐使用 Docker 安装,方便管理和后续升级。

1. 安装 Docker:

如果尚未安装 Docker,请前往 Docker 官网 下载并安装适合您操作系统的版本。

2. 拉取并运行 Open WebUI 镜像:

打开终端或命令提示符,执行以下命令:

docker run -d -p 3000:8080 -v /data/open-webui:/app/backend/data --name open-webui --restart always ghcr.io/open-webui/open-webui:main

这条命令会:

  • 以守护进程模式运行 Open WebUI 容器。
  • 将容器的 8080 端口映射到主机的 3000 端口。
  • 设置容器的名称为 open-webui,并在容器退出时自动重启。
  • 使用官方的 Open WebUI 镜像。

3. 访问 Open WebUI:

在浏览器中输入 http://localhost:3000/ 即可访问 Open WebUI。

注意事项:

  • 首次运行时,可能需要配置代理以加速镜像的下载。
  • 确保您的系统已安装 Docker,并且 Docker 服务正在运行。

更多详细信息和功能介绍,请参考官方文档。

分享至:

评论

- 위키
Copyright © 2011-2025 iteam. Current version is 2.142.0. UTC+08:00, 2025-02-22 02:13
浙ICP备14020137号-1 $방문자$